Staff Recommendation
APPROVE the request for a church at this location as shown on the development plan subject to 7 conditions
1. Meeting all applicable requirements of the Knox County Health Dept.
2. Meeting all applicable requirements of the Knoxville City Arborist.
3. Installing the proposed landscaping as shown on the landscape plan within six months of the issuance of an occupancy permit.
4. In order to obtain a street connection permit, relocate the driveway entrance at Dry Gap Pike to provide a minimum of 125' of separation from Jim Sterchi Rd. and at a location that will provide at least 300' of sight distance in each direction or locate the driveway as directed by the Knoxville City Engineer.
5. Meeting all applicable requirements of the Knoxville City Engineer.
6. A revised site plan reflecting the conditions of approval must be submitted to MPC staff prior to issuance of any building permits.
7. Meeting all applicable requirements of the Knoxville Zoning Ordinance.
With the conditions noted, this plan meets the requirements for approval in the RP-1 District and the other criteria for approval of a use on review.
